svn如何上传到服务器

不及物动词 其他 74

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要将SVN上的代码上传到服务器,可以按照以下步骤进行操作:

    1. 确定服务器上已经安装了SVN服务器软件,例如Apache Subversion或VisualSVN等。
    2. 在服务器上创建一个用于存储代码的目录,例如"svn_repository"。
    3. 在SVN服务器上创建一个代码库,命令如下:
    svnadmin create /path/to/svn_repository/repository_name
    

    其中,/path/to/svn_repository是代码库存储的路径,repository_name是代码库的名称。
    4. 为代码库配置访问权限,可以设置不同用户组的读写权限等。
    5. 在本地电脑上使用SVN客户端工具(如TortoiseSVN)将代码上传到服务器。具体操作如下:
    a. 在本地创建一个工作副本(Working Copy),命令如下:

    svn checkout svn://server_address/path/to/svn_repository/repository_name local_folder
    

    其中,server_address是服务器地址,/path/to/svn_repository/repository_name是代码库的路径,local_folder是本地文件夹路径。
    b. 将代码拷贝到本地文件夹中。
    c. 使用SVN客户端提交代码到服务器,命令如下:

    svn commit -m "Commit message" local_folder
    

    其中,-m参数是提交信息,local_folder是本地文件夹路径。
    6. 完成代码上传后,其他用户就可以从服务器上检出代码,进行更新和修改。

    以上就是将SVN上的代码上传到服务器的步骤。请根据实际情况进行操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要将svn项目上传到服务器,需要执行以下步骤:

    1. 检出项目:首先,你需要在服务器上配置svn服务器,并在本地使用svn客户端检出(checkout)项目代码。通过运行以下命令,指定svn服务器的URL和本地文件夹的路径来完成检出:
    svn checkout <URL> <local_folder>
    
    1. 编辑代码:在本地文件夹中进行所需的修改和编辑。你可以使用任何喜欢的编辑器来修改代码文件。

    2. 提交修改:完成所需的修改后,使用svn客户端提交(commit)你的修改。通过运行以下命令,将本地修改推送到svn服务器:

    svn commit -m "commit message"
    

    其中,"commit message"是提交的说明,可以简要概述所做的修改。

    1. 更新服务器代码:如果有其他开发人员在svn服务器上提交了修改,你需要将这些修改同步到你的本地代码库中。使用svn客户端运行以下命令,更新本地代码库:
    svn update
    
    1. 解决冲突:如果在更新本地代码时,发生了代码冲突(即多个人对同一行代码进行了不同的修改),则需要手动解决冲突。svn会在冲突的文件中标记冲突的位置,并生成冲突文件。你需要打开冲突文件,查看冲突的位置,并根据需要进行修改。

    2. 上传到服务器:完成所有修改后,使用svn客户端将最新代码上传到svn服务器。使用以下命令来上传代码:

    svn update
    svn commit -m "commit message"
    

    以上就是将svn上传到服务器的基本步骤。通过这些步骤,你可以轻松地将本地svn项目上传到服务器,并与团队成员共享和协作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    SVN是一种版本控制系统,它可以帮助团队协同开发并管理代码。将代码上传到服务器的过程主要分为以下几个步骤:

    1. 安装SVN服务器:首先需要在服务器上安装SVN服务器软件,常用的SVN服务器软件包括VisualSVN Server、CollabNet SVN Server等。安装完成后,配置服务器的相关参数。

    2. 创建代码仓库:在SVN服务器上创建一个代码仓库,用于存储项目的代码。通常创建一个主仓库,在该仓库下可以创建多个项目的子目录。

    3. 创建SVN用户:为了进行代码上传和下载,需要在SVN服务器上创建一个或多个SVN用户。用户的身份验证方式可以选择基于密码的验证或基于证书的验证。

    4. 在本地工作目录中设置SVN:在本地电脑上使用SVN客户端软件(如TortoiseSVN、SVN Command Line等)设置SVN源路径以及目标路径。

    5. 导入代码到SVN:将本地项目的代码导入到SVN服务器上的代码仓库中。在本地选择项目的根目录,右键点击选择"SVN Import",然后在对话框中填入SVN服务器的URL和待导入的仓库路径。

    6. 检出代码:在本地创建一个空的目录作为工作副本,通过检出操作将SVN服务器上的代码下载到本地。选择目标目录,右键点击选择"SVN Checkout",然后在对话框中填入SVN服务器的URL和本地目录路径。

    7. 提交代码:在本地对项目进行修改后,将修改后的代码提交到SVN服务器。选择项目根目录,右键点击选择"SVN Commit",然后在对话框中填写修改的描述信息,点击"OK"提交代码。

    8. 更新代码:其他人员对代码进行修改后,可以通过更新操作将最新的代码同步到本地。选择本地目录,右键点击选择"SVN Update",然后等待更新完成。

    上述步骤仅是一个基本的流程,具体操作可能因SVN服务器软件以及SVN客户端软件的不同而有所差异。因此,在具体操作时,可以根据所使用的软件的操作指南进行操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部